There is a demand for the service, but it's not a good add on service.

To do it right it takes a different set of equipment and probably a different crew.

It's not going to generally be done at the same time, average system takes 4-5 hours to process and using billing $100.00 hour average.

Not hard if you're mechanical but not exactly easy. Dirty work, hot in the summer, cold in the winter.
